Why Austin? The Perfect Retreat Destination

Austin combines a vibrant culture with a laid-back atmosphere, making it an ideal location for team retreats. Known for its music scene, outdoor activities, and diverse culinary options, Austin offers a refreshing break from the office. The best times to visit are spring (March to May) and fall (September to November) when the weather is pleasant and hotel rates are reasonable.

Getting There

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) is located just 20 minutes from downtown, making it easily accessible for your team. Budget for approximately $50-100 per person for round-trip flights, depending on where you’re traveling from.

Sample 3-Day Itinerary

Day 1: Arrival & Team Building

  • Morning: Arrival and check-in at your chosen venue.
  • Afternoon: Welcome lunch at the venue's restaurant (budget $30/person).
  • Evening: Team-building activity at Zilker Park (budget $40/person for equipment rental).

Day 2: Workshops & Strategy

  • Morning: Breakfast at venue (included).
  • Mid-Morning: Workshop on team productivity led by a facilitator (budget $1,500 for 4 hours).
  • Afternoon: Lunch at nearby food trucks (budget $15/person).
  • Evening: Dinner at a local BBQ restaurant (budget $50/person).

Day 3: Reflection & Departure

  • Morning: Breakfast at venue (included).
  • Mid-Morning: Reflection session to discuss learnings (no cost).
  • Afternoon: Wrap-up lunch and check-out (budget $30/person).

Budget Breakdown

| Item | Estimated Cost | Percentage of Total | |---------------------|----------------------|---------------------| | Venue Rental | $4,000 | 40% | | Food & Beverage | $2,500 | 25% | | Activities | $1,500 | 15% | | Travel | $1,000 | 15% | | Contingency | $500 | 5% | | Total | $10,500 | 100% |

Planning Timeline

8-Week Planning Milestones

  • Week 8: Define goals and objectives for the retreat.
  • Week 7: Choose a venue and finalize dates.
  • Week 6: Secure catering and activity vendors.
  • Week 5: Send out invitations and gather dietary restrictions.
  • Week 4: Finalize agenda and logistics.
  • Week 3: Confirm all bookings and send reminders.
  • Week 2: Prepare materials and supplies.
  • Week 1: Conduct a final check-in with all vendors.

Risk Mitigation

  • Potential Issue: Venue cancellation due to unforeseen circumstances.

    • Prevention: Secure a flexible cancellation policy.
  • Potential Issue: Dietary restrictions not communicated.

    • Prevention: Collect dietary preferences early and confirm with catering.
